Our objective was to characterize a resilient talar located within a suburban forest that has been invaded by exotic vegetation, in order to identify the patterns and processes currently affecting the native woody species. Methods: The forest (55 ha) was divided into seven sampling sites. We assessed the abundance and physiognomic variables of native woody species through random searches (237 hours with 2 people). For woody exotics, we used a combination of transects and grids (96 hours with 2 people). The analyses included descriptive statistics, index calculations, one-way ANOVAs, and Kruskal-Wallis tests. Results: Two native species co-dominated the talar: CT (88%) and SB (11%), while other native woody species were extremely rare (1%). Woody exotics were dominant both structurally and numerically, particularly five species that were extremely abundant in the area. Significant variation was observed in the height of CT and SB among forest sites, with individuals less than 3 meters tall being the most common. The Mantle Index varied significantly between older (balanced mantle) and younger (unbalanced mantle) trees, indicating strong competition for light due to shading from exotic species. The proportion of CT that were standing dead, crushed, damaged by basal pruning, or sprouting varied significantly among forest sites.
